Need help with a problem with a Sega Master System

Recommended Posts

Picked up a Sega master system cheap at a flea market yesterday the thing was NASTY! I cleaned it up got it all hooked up and it powered on and I started playing Hang on the built in game. I don't have any carts for it. Anyway I tried both controllers and I can't get the motorcycle to move left. It's not the controllers unless both are broken. Could it be something wrong with the control port? Or what?

I have seen a few cases where the board is cracked just behind the controller ports, presumably from being stepped on. A few jumper wires solved it. Had another one that had a broken wire in the controller cable. Try using a Genesis controller on it or try using the SMS controls on an Atari 2600 or similar. It'll narrow it down.
